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Newton for Hyde to Adisham start from as little as £49.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Newton for Hyde to Adisham start from £99.10 one way, or £141.70 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Newton for Hyde to Adisham are available for £232.40 one way, or £464.80 return

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Newton for Hyde station ensures a smooth ticket purchasing process with its ticket office, open early during weekdays and Saturdays, alongside a ticket machine for easy access. However, please note that the station lacks accessible ticket machines. For those with hearing impairments, induction loops are available to assist. Although the station lacks public conveniences such as toilets and baby changing facilities, CCTV is in place for added security. For travelers with mobility impairments, the station's Category C status signifies complex accessibility, with ramps and steps detailed in their accessibility guide. Unfortunately, there's no provision for waiting rooms inside the station, but there is a seating area available for use.

Facilities and Amenities at Adisham Station

Adisham Station is equipped with essential facilities designed for a smooth travel experience. While there is no ticket office available, you will find ticket machines to purchase or collect your tickets with ease. The station ensures inclusivity with accessible ticket machines and an induction loop, although it's important to note there are no Smartcard services available here.

Although you won't find refreshments or shops on-site, the station maintains convenience through an ample seating area and customer help points. While CCTV provides security, it's best to plan ahead as there are no toilet facilities or waiting rooms. For those who require assistance, staff and mobile help teams are available, making sure everyone can embark on their journey comfortably.

Accessibility and Support

Adisham station may not have a full suite of accessibility options, but it ensures some degree of step-free access. London-bound platform 1 is reachable via an unmade path, while Dover-bound platform 2 can be accessed from the car park. It’s worth mentioning there is no step-free interchange between platforms. Assistance can also be arranged in advance for a more seamless travel experience.
